📚 Topic Summary
Wave speed is how fast a wave travels through a medium. It's determined by two main factors: the wave's frequency (how many waves pass a point per second) and its wavelength (the distance between two corresponding points on a wave, like crest to crest). The formula that connects these is: Wave Speed = Frequency × Wavelength.
Understanding wave speed helps us understand everything from sound to light! Let's work through some problems!
